Magallon wrote: : > > It looks really silly to have a motd say "wellcome to this box, it has > 2 xeons and 1022 Mb of RAM". Ok, everyone seems to go with his idea on this thread so I'd like to share mine too :-P If you want to know how much _physical_ memory there is on your computer, then a good way would be too use dmidecode. The parsing might require more work than a "du" but you will never have trouble with rounding...
